Runbook: if the Plotline address autocomplete widget stops returning suggestions in your plugin, first confirm the host page loads the loader script before your init call. A blank dropdown usually means the session handshake timed out. Retry once with a fresh session, then capture the widget's diagnostic panel. Include in your report the trace token shown below.

trace token, fafog-kageg: htk4_98e6

Fan-out backpressure for the Quillet notifier: when the queue depth crosses the soft limit, the dispatcher sheds low-priority pushes and batches the rest at 500ms intervals. Reviewer should confirm the shed counter is exported and that retries respect the jitter window. Once merged, the release artifact gets re-signed by the pipeline, which expects the deploy key shown below.

deploy key for bawep-yawif: bky6_GQhaSt

## Deploying the Gatewick Proctor Queue

Deploys are pretty painless: push to main, wait for the pipeline, then watch the queue drain dashboard for five minutes. If candidates pile up mid-exam, roll back first and ask questions later — the queue replays safely. Everything the workers care about lives in one config block, shown here for reference.

settings of bafof-yagef:
JOROX_PIN=8740
JOROX_TENANT=pelox
JOROX_METRICS_HOST=metrics.jorox.qorvelworks.internal
JOROX_SEAL=seal_c78f63c1
JOROX_STANDBY_TEAM=norax

**Runbook 4.2 — Calendar Sync Conflict Recovery**

When a Tidewell Calendar account shows duplicate events after a sync conflict, first pause the sync agent, then run the dedupe job from the admin console. If the account is locked afterward, use the recovery flow rather than a password reset. The flow will prompt for the team recovery passphrase, noted below.

strongbox words: norwyn-wenael-aldvan-aldiel-wendor-holael

Test plan for export retries (Fernhop). Quick one for sync: we're simulating flaky downstream writes by killing the Brindlecask mock mid-transfer, then checking the job retries with backoff and doesn't duplicate rows. Also covering the poison-pill case where three failures should park the export. Runs go through the staging scheduler, which needs auth — grab the token below to kick them off.

login token, kagaf-bawig: eyJhbGciOiJIUzI1NiIsInR5cCI6IkpXVCJ9.eyJzdWIiOiI1b8bmcIn0.xjc0uBP3